About this tag
This tag covers discussions on engineering policy advocacy, focusing on how professional engineering institutions (PEIs) in Malaysia are evolving from certification bodies into active policy advocates. Topics include the role of PEIs in shaping engineering education, influencing national technological and economic strategies, and meeting the growing demand for skilled engineers. The content highlights the proactive and integral role these institutions play in advancing the engineering profession through policy engagement.
